IT Operations

The IT Operations service is focussed on IT availability, production performance and SLAs.

This service is generally used by two distinct types of client. The first type is where the production systems are viewed as unstable and prone to failure whereas the second is more interested in risk management, such as capacity planning, Disaster Recovery and Supplier SLAs.

Often this service will look at monitoring and automatic alerting, particularly where the production systems need the ability to 'self-heal' following a failure. Such functionality is applied across the both the application software and the underlying IT infrastructure.

Other aspects that are often important are the ITIL Framework, especially Change Management - after all, there is a reason why production systems are at their most stable during a change freeze!

Incident management and Knowledge Bases are both significant areas of expertise in this practice and are currently going through a period of sustained growth.
